diff options
author | Gary Wu <gary.i.wu@huawei.com> | 2017-09-14 13:51:00 -0700 |
---|---|---|
committer | Gary Wu <gary.i.wu@huawei.com> | 2017-09-14 13:51:00 -0700 |
commit | 2ca2b9f6f36b8a1698ce162abac53a5cb3c2856e (patch) | |
tree | 3ff1b902c1c5a5fbba3e5d7daf15867a95141988 /test | |
parent | a96b4bf5b917166b78e72ad504e718e905313d84 (diff) |
Add return checks and logging for docker functions
Change-Id: I7cf2bf9397006034b155557bf4d4b155a5626a7a
Issue-ID: INT-200
Signed-off-by: Gary Wu <gary.i.wu@huawei.com>
Diffstat (limited to 'test')
-rw-r--r-- | test/csit/tests/integration/vCPE/test1.robot | 11 |
1 files changed, 10 insertions, 1 deletions
diff --git a/test/csit/tests/integration/vCPE/test1.robot b/test/csit/tests/integration/vCPE/test1.robot index d9a9baf95..01a14e62f 100644 --- a/test/csit/tests/integration/vCPE/test1.robot +++ b/test/csit/tests/integration/vCPE/test1.robot @@ -17,15 +17,24 @@ SO ServiceInstance health check Run Docker [Arguments] ${image} ${name} ${parameters}=${EMPTY} ${result}= Run Process docker run --name ${name} ${parameters} -d ${image} shell=True - Log all output: ${result.stdout} + Should Be Equal As Integers ${result.rc} 0 + Log ${result.stdout} ${result}= Run Process docker inspect --format '{{ .NetworkSettings.IPAddress }}' ${name} shell=True + Should Be Equal As Integers ${result.rc} 0 + Log ${result.stdout} [Return] ${result.stdout} Kill Docker [Arguments] ${name} ${result}= Run Process docker logs ${name} shell=True + Should Be Equal As Integers ${result.rc} 0 + Log ${result.stdout} ${result}= Run Process docker kill ${name} shell=True + Should Be Equal As Integers ${result.rc} 0 + Log ${result.stdout} ${result}= Run Process docker rm ${name} shell=True + Should Be Equal As Integers ${result.rc} 0 + Log ${result.stdout} CheckUrl [Arguments] ${url} |